Kanye West knows exactly who he wants to show up at his funeral, in addition to his close friends and family, of course.

In newly released behind the scenes video footage from his “Watch the Throne” tour with Jay-Z, the outspoken rapper says he wants to inspire the world’s most powerful people to the point where they would attend his funeral when he dies.

“I was just thinking about my funeral and stuff a couple days ago and thinking who would be at the funeral. People who I want to be in the funeral. I wanna have world leaders that were, like, affected, that said, you know, ‘Kanye gave me my shot here.’ Or ‘he pushed me,’ or ‘he told me to believe in myself,’ or ‘when I saw this, it made me feel like that.’ I wanna affect people like that when I, like, pass away.”

The clip is a part of a series of intimate, behind the scenes videos released by VOYR, who charges fans $5 per month for an all-access pass to the happenings behind the scenes of the WTT tour, including candid conversations both rappers — Kanye and Jay-Z — have as they prepare for show time.
